What is the 70 30 rule in negotiation?

Follow the 70/30 rule – listen 70% of the time and talk only 30% of the time. Encourage the other person to talk by asking open-ended questions – questions that start with “how”, “why” and “what if”. This technique is about understanding the other person's position.

What are the three types of negotiators?

There are many different types of people in this world, but there are only three types of negotiators: Analysts, Accommodators, and Assertives. The best negotiators incorporate characteristics of all three types into their strategy and know how to shift their communication style to better fit their counterpart.

What is the 3 second rule in negotiation?

The best tool to use is the 3 second rule. The Journal of Applied Psychology showed that sitting silently for at least 3 seconds during a difficult time negotiation or conversation leads to better outcomes. Embrace silence as your stealth strategy.

What is the 5 2 negotiation?

The 5+2 format, also known as the 5+2 talks, the 5+2 negotiations and the 5+2 process, is a diplomatic negotiation platform aimed at finding a solution to the Transnistria conflict between Moldova and the unrecognized state of Transnistria.

What is the Chris Voss method?

Chris Voss swears by the “no-oriented questions” approach to negotiations. In this method, the goal is to get the prospect to say no, instead of trying to get a “Yes” right away. Saying no triggers a safe feeling, and a sense of agency. If either party can say no, neither one feels superior or inferior to the other.

What are the three C's of negotiation?

Most people know intuitively that if they are to be convincing, they need to be confident, and if they are to be confident, they need to be comfortable (comfortable, confident, and convincing are what I term the three C's of negotiation).

What is a BATNA in negotiation?

The best alternative to a negotiated agreement (BATNA) is a course of action a party will take if talks fail and no agreement can be reached during negotiations.
